Abstract

A client device requests permission from a network access device to access a network associated with the network access device. The client device sends credentials of a user associated with the client device for authenticating with the network access device. The client device receives from the network access device permission to access the network along with a session certificate and an associated key. The session certificate and the key are associated with the credentials of the user. The client device establishes a network session using the network based on receiving the permission. During the network session, the client device establishes a secure communications channel with a website. The client device authenticates the user to the website by sending the session certificate to the website over the secure communications channel. The client device then receives permission from the website to access contents of the website.
